Opec-Plus
  • Opec-plus’ decision to speed up supply additions in May primarily reflects internal dynamics, particularly frustration with chronic overproducers Kazakhstan and Iraq. Despite the group’s stated rationale of increasing output on the back of a “healthier” market outlook, we see oil fundamentals as increasingly bearish. The group will release an extra 411,000 b/d in May instead of the planned 135,000 b/d. It hopes a new, front-loaded schedule for “compensation cuts” will mitigate the impact. Our soundings indicate that of eight members due to release extra volumes in May, only two would do so once compensation cuts are factored in.
